Princess Ann, played by Hepburn, is on a whirlwind tour of Europe representing her country and is stopped in Rome. The film tells us all about a young woman who can speak many languages, always stands up straight, and follows all the rules...even though it is driving her crazy. So she sneaks out of the Embassy and has her own little Roman holiday under the guise of woman named Anya. Introduce Gregory Peck as Joe an American reporter and you have a darned good story!

I think my favorite two parts are as follows: first, I love when Ann cuts her hair. Just like in Sabrina it really changes her whole look. Second, I love when they visit the Mouth of Truth. I love it mostly because it is such a cute part of the film. But also in the movie Only You they reenact this part with Marissa Tomei and Robert Downey, Jr.
Another fun fact, how many of you have seen Green Acres? Eddie Albert plays Oliver in that TV series, a great series. He also plays Joe's friend Irving who has a fancy camera that functions as a cigarette lighter as well.
